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8659 6135559130 22358697 553 04
9077501 76977475 22
9077501 76977475 22
776094 4933277 2283
All about undefined
Interested in learning more?
9077501 76977475 22
776094 4933277 2283
See more
68895 4262948706 36
87436849 9044 419
See more
339477750 67
3167514 4780 78243297125
See more